和记娱乐线上 Best Practices

和记娱乐线上 最佳做法提取,转换和加载(和记娱乐线上)流程是每个组织的核心’的数据管理策略。 和记娱乐线上 过程中的每一步–从各种来源获取数据,重塑数据,应用业务规则,将数据加载到适当的目的地并验证结果–是保持正确数据流向的重要工具。建立一套和记娱乐线上最佳实践将使这些流程更加健壮和一致。

经过十多年的发展’我花了移动和转换数据,’ve找到了适用于大多数每种负载情况的通用和记娱乐线上最佳实践得分。遵循这些最佳实践将导致具有以下特征的加载过程:

  • 可靠
  • 弹性的
  • 可重用
  • 可维护的
  • 表现良好
  • 安全

我充实的大多数示例都使用 SQL服务器集成服务。但是,以下设计模式适用于使用大多数和记娱乐线上工具在任何体系结构上运行的流程。所以不管你’重新使用SSIS,Informatica, 塔伦德,老式的T-SQL或其他工具,这些和记娱乐线上最佳做法模式仍将适用。

I’小心不要将这些最佳做法指定为严格的规则。即使对于似乎是该过程至关重要的概念(例如日志记录),也肯定会存在一些极端情况,从而消除了对其中一个或多个需求的需要。但是,对于大多数和记娱乐线上流程而言,以下详细介绍的最佳实践应被视为体系结构的核心。

我下面’ve列出了大多数和记娱乐线上实施的关键要素。在接下来的几周和几个月里,我’我们将详细介绍每个博客。

和记娱乐线上 最佳做法

什么是和记娱乐线上? 对于那些不熟悉和记娱乐线上的人,这篇简短的文章是通向最佳实践的第一步。

什么,为什么,何时以及如何增加负载。仅加载新的或更改的内容,以加快加载过程并提高其准确性。

记录中:正确的日志记录策略是任何和记娱乐线上体系结构成功的关键。在本文中,我分享了有关记录和记娱乐线上操作的一些基本概念。

稽核。没有错误的负载不一定是成功的负载。精心设计的流程不仅可以检查错误,还可以支持对行数,财务金额和其他指标的审核。

数据沿袭。了解数据的来源,何时加载以及如何转换对于下游数据的完整性以及将数据移至那里的过程至关重要。

和记娱乐线上 模块化。在大多数开发领域中,创建可重用的代码结构都很重要,在和记娱乐线上流程中更是如此。 和记娱乐线上 模块化有助于避免一遍又一遍地编写相同的困难代码,并减少维护和记娱乐线上体系结构所需的总精力。

和记娱乐线上 原子性。每个和记娱乐线上流程应该有多大?在本文中,我将讨论适当调整和记娱乐线上逻辑的优点。

错误处理。出问题了怎么办?这篇文章回顾了围绕和记娱乐线上流程中的错误预防和管理的设计模式。

管理不良数据。当发现可疑数据时,需要有一个用于清理或管理不合格数据行的系统。在本文中,我分享了一些处理不良数据的设计模式。

让您的电子邮件脱离我的和记娱乐线上。每个工作都有适当的工具。直接将电子邮件通知嵌入和记娱乐线上流程会增加不必要的复杂性和潜在的故障点。

使用和记娱乐线上登台表。通常,使用临时登台表可以提高性能并降低和记娱乐线上流程的复杂性。

保护您的数据准备区。数据使用者不应访问当前正在处理的数据的暂存区或着陆区。否则,您可能会遇到数据不良,分析冲突或潜在的安全风险的情况。